GM 450 Panama-California Exposition “1915 All the Year 1915”
Multicolored cards printed by Teich (CTCo Chicago logo in circle on back)
“Published by Panama-California Exposition, San Diego, Cal. 1915. Made in U.S.A.” on green back with Expo logo
“Published by Panama-California Exposition, San Diego, Cal. 1915.” on blue back
- (R-49691) Colonnade and Patio Southern California Counties Building
- (R-49643) From a Cool Colonnade (this card is not cut off at bottom)
- (R-49692) West Entrance, Foreign Arts Building and Tower of Home Economy Building (includes “As it Appears Today, Five Months Before the Opening”)
Variations, all with same views:
- blue back without Expo logo
- green back with Expo logo
- 1916 expo ad overprinted in red on back
- “As it appears today, five months before the opening” overprinted in red caps on front, blue back
- “Official View” overprinted in red on front
- “Santa Fe The Expo Line” overprinted in purple on front
- “Santa Fe The Exposition Line” overprinted on 2 lines in larger purple on front
- West Entrance, Foreign Arts Building and Tower of Home Economy Building (“As it Appears Today, Five Months Before the Opening” trimmed from bottom-card is shorter)
